Abstract: From all the data gathered, both from the diverse literatures and from the farm experiences, a good level of dairy cattle reproduction was noticed and registered amongst the 5 farms investigated. Furthermore, the Maltese dairy cattle reproduction is overall satisfactory especially because the ideal average of pregnancy is maintained. Maltese farmers do have basic knowledge about topics like; timing of insemination, avoidance of heat stress, check rectal palpation for good ovaries, rebreed again if cows are diagnosed not pregnant, postpartum examinations and pregnancy diagnosis. Nonetheless, pathological investigation regarding certain diseases, reproductive failures and disorders, record keeping and nutrition could be given their due importance by the Maltese farmers. Veterinarians and a cattle breeder were also important in carrying out my investigations and confirming results leading to the enhancement of the knowledge of dairy cattle reproduction.
